PHP是一種腳本語言,通常用于Web開發,它的主要用途是在服務器端處理Web請求。然而,隨著移動應用市場迅速發展,越來越多的開發者開始考慮使用PHP了。
PHP雖然不是移動設備的本地編程語言,但是它可以很好地支持移動應用程序的開發,而且可以與多種技術集成。
PHP開發移動應用程序的好處:
1.快速開發:PHP是一種易于學習的語言,很容易上手,因此開發者可以快速開發移動應用程序。
2.跨平臺:PHP的無平臺依賴性確保了代碼在不同的設備上同時運行,因此開發者可以在多個平臺上發布應用程序。
3.靈活性:PHP應用程序支持多種開發框架和技術,使得開發者可以選擇最合適的框架和技術來開發應用程序。
以下是一些PHP開發移動應用程序的方法:
1.使用Web服務:在移動應用程序中,通過Web服務將PHP與其他平臺集成。Web服務可以幫助我們在不同的應用程序之間共享數據。
2.使用框架:PHP的許多框架支持移動應用程序開發。這些框架提供面向對象的編程方法,以及許多其他功能,如API開發、ORM等。
3.使用移動應用程序開發工具包:開發人員可以使用不同的移動應用程序開發工具包,如PhoneGap、Sencha Touch等,與PHP一起使用。
4.使用移動后端即服務:移動BaaS是云服務,為移動應用程序提供后端功能。開發人員可以使用PHP與BaaS集成,在應用程序中使用它的功能。
例如,解決方案:
Laravel作為一種廣泛應用的PHP框架,它的很多功能都可以有效地用于app的開發。 使用Laravel框架,開發人員可以快速構建API,這些API可以提供與移動應用程序交互所需的所有數據和函數。
此外,PHP可以與許多流行的移動應用程序開發工具包集成,如PhoneGap,這可以幫助開發人員輕松地創建跨平臺應用程序。
總的來說,盡管PHP不是作為移動應用程序的本地編程語言設計的,但是通過使用適當的技術和框架,PHP可以很好地支持移動應用程序的開發。對于在Web開發中熟悉PHP開發的開發者來說,這是一個很好的選擇,因為可以使用相同的技術和語言來創建移動應用程序。